Wah Chang is one of my heroes; as with W. Matt Jeffries, Brian Johnson, Joe Johnston, and Syd Mead he literally shaped my dreams.

Chang's props (Communicator, Tricorder, Phaser) may well represent the first unified vision for a future technology in all of filmed Sci-Fi; not just a walkie talkie, a pistol, and a portable computer, but three devices created by the same society, from the same materials, and ergonomically crafted to be used in the field. They are still spawning new iterations to this day. It's truly remarkable.

So here's an important tidbit.

Yes, racism played its role in the talented Wah Chang's mistreatment. However, if we look at the bridge crew in both the first and second pilot, it's all rather "whitebread." NBC studio execs passed down a network-wide order for more diverse casting, leading to "Uhura," and "Sulu" being on the bridge by "The Corbomite Maneuver." "Chekov" would become a regular cast member in the second season. So the situation was complex, with some forces enforcing racism in the US, and others trying to erode it. The more things change....

Star Trek was also not a very union-friendly production. The producers write in "Inside Star Trek" how they would commission costumes from non-Union sweatshops, and then smuggle those costumes into the Paramount lot. Star Trek was relatively expensive to produce for the time, and Desilu was a studio suffering from mismanagement and mixed receptions for its shows.
